What Is LGBTQIA+ Therapy?
Initially, it can be useful to comprehend the acronym LGBTQ+. LGBTQ+ means lesbian, gay, bisexual, transgender, questioning/queer, and also the plus sign at the end is to consist of all other identifications within the area. There are comparable acronyms you may see made use of, such as LGBTQIA2S+, which means lesbian, gay, bisexual, transgender, questioning/queer, intersex, nonsexual, two-spirit.
Like allyship, suppliers specializing in collaborating with the LGBTQ+ community aren’t just about surface-level approval or resistance. There’s a significant distinction between the addition of a community or demographic group and also sources developed specifically for that neighborhood or demographic team. LGBTQ+ therapy is built for the LGBTQ+ neighborhood and also their experiences. Treatment ought to supply a safeguarded, mindful, as well as compassionate setting where a person can get care from a service provider who understands exactly how being LGBTQ+ can educate an individual’s experiences.
Why Is There A Need For LGBTQIA+ Treatment?
Marginalized neighborhoods are substantially more probable to experience mental health problems. Especially if you experience marginalization in even more methods than one, accessing care can be challenging. Stats suggest that:
LGBTQ+ young adults are six times more likely to experience a psychological health and wellness problem when contrasted to teenagers who aren’t LGBTQ+.
A 2019 survey revealed that 3% of LGBTQ+ youth have been bothered or attacked at college. 59.1% really felt harmful at college due to their sexual orientation, and also 42.5% really felt risky due to their sex expression.
One in three LGBTQ+ grownups is claimed to face a mental health problem, whereas one in every five adults that are not LGBTQ+ do so.
15% of LGBTQ+ people are claimed to encounter a Compound Usage Problem, whereas 8% of individuals who are not LGBTQ+ do so.
Discrimination, harassment, and also bullying are all understood physical as well as psychological health and wellness hinderances. Research study shows that the even more discrimination, stigma, as well as general marginalization a person deals with, the more serious their mental wellness end results are. When the concern is, “Why are LGBTQ+ individuals most likely to experience a mental illness or disorder?” It’s very important to keep in mind that the solution relates to the treatment of LGBTQ+ people instead of merely belonging of the community.
Discrimination And Also Stigma In Healthcare Professionals
Health care needs to constantly be a secure area. Unfortunately, that is not always the instance for marginalized communities, including the LGBTQ+ area. Discrimination as well as preconception from health care specialists or companies can show up in different methods. These may include but aren’t restricted to the rejection of fertility treatment, withholding of the age of puberty blockers as well as hormone replacement therapy (HRT), being declined for health care services (whether those solutions relate to sexuality as well as gender or otherwise), as well as failing to acknowledge varying sexual experiences along with experiences bordering your gender and also how they may inform your wellness or health care needs.
The levels in which discrimination as well as preconception appear in healthcare might differ. Some service providers can be outright intolerant, whereas others do not know the LGBTQ+ community and also their health care requires. In some cases a carrier won’t understand that they’re causing damage. Nevertheless, this can be activating and also can serve as a barrier to having your healthcare needs addressed. This is part of why queer-affirming medical and psychological healthcare techniques are so crucial. It might be tougher to locate encouraging and also affirming treatment in remote areas or locations that are normally much less approving of the LGBTQ+ area.
